James F. Dicke II is an internationally recognized artist, known for his innovative approach to painting and sculpture. His work has been exhibited in prominent institutions and corporate collections such as the Smithsonian American Art Museum, NASA, The Mandarin Oriental Hotel and the Long Beach Museum of Area.
Dicke began painting at the age of eighteen when he studied under Warner Williams, as a bas-relief artist. Dicke is also the Chairman and CEO of Crown Equipment Corporation. In his art, Dicke draws inspiration from nature and his contemporary art collection which includes emerging artists and established names such as Philip Pearlstein and John Currin.
